Got a reply from the guy who posted a message on AOL about a C development
system for the Zoomer. I've encouraged him (?) to subscribe to this list and
post details here, but here's a summary of the status of the project:

--- Forwarded mail from ContheZ@aol.com

[...] Bascially, though, it uses the Personal C Compiler with special
libraries to access the Z functionality under DOS (power management, an
on-screen keyboard, the digitizer, comm, graphics. etc.) With minor
exceptions, it is ready to go. Putting the final touches is all that really
remains. [...]
